How to cook a pig, Hawaiian style. At our 4th annual pig roast, we shot some clips to show you how to cook a whole pig (ours was 180+ pounds) Hawaiian style - wrapped in banana leaves and buried in the ground. This was done at the Rosewood Manor in Edmonds Washington during the summer of 2010.

Well done, but I found that a number of steps in this video are unnecessary for creating a sweet and tender Hawaiian roasted pig. For example, the pit doesn't need to be so deep, coals/stones don't need to be raked on each side of the pig, lava rocks aren't necessary (river rocks do well), hot dirty rocks don't need to be placed in the pig cavity (pineapples actually add sweet flavor), and you don't have to use so much firewood and burn for such a long time.
